What are the Best Practices for Installing Spark Plugs in 1986 Chevy C20?
The best practices for installing spark plugs in a 1986 Chevy C20 include ensuring the correct spark plug gap, using anti-seize on threads, and following proper tightening torque specifications.
- Verify the correct spark plug type
- Check and adjust spark plug gap
- Clean the spark plug threads
- Apply anti-seize compound
- Use a torque wrench for tightening
- Follow the installation sequence
- Inspect ignition wires and components
Following these points is essential for optimal engine performance and longevity.
-
Verify the Correct Spark Plug Type: Verifying the correct spark plug type involves checking the manufacturer’s specifications for the 1986 Chevy C20. Using an incorrect spark plug can lead to poor engine performance or damage. For this vehicle, the recommended spark plug is usually a standard type, such as AC Delco R45TS. Refer to the vehicle’s manual for specific details.
-
Check and Adjust Spark Plug Gap: Checking and adjusting the spark plug gap ensures optimal combustion in the engine. The recommended gap for the 1986 Chevy C20 is typically around 0.035 inches. A gap that is too wide or too narrow can affect the spark intensity, potentially leading to misfires or inefficient fuel combustion. Use a feeler gauge to measure and configure the gap accurately.
-
Clean the Spark Plug Threads: Cleaning the spark plug threads is necessary to prevent contaminants from affecting the installation. Dirt or debris can lead to inaccurate torque readings and may cause the spark plug to seize. Use a wire brush or a spray cleaner to remove any residue from the threads before installation.
-
Apply Anti-Seize Compound: Applying anti-seize compound to the threads of the spark plug helps prevent seizing and makes future removal easier. This can be especially important for aluminum engine blocks. Only a small amount is needed on the threads, as excessive application can affect torque readings.
-
Use a Torque Wrench for Tightening: Using a torque wrench ensures that you tighten the spark plugs to the manufacturer’s recommended specifications. For the 1986 Chevy C20, the typical torque specification is around 11-15 lb-ft. Incorrect torque can cause damage to the spark plug or the engine.
-
Follow the Installation Sequence: Following the correct installation sequence is important to prevent uneven pressure and ensure a proper seal. For a V8 engine, start at the center and move outward diagonally to ensure even distribution.
-
Inspect Ignition Wires and Components: Inspecting ignition wires and components during spark plug installation is crucial for overall system efficiency. Worn or damaged wires can lead to ignition problems. Replace any brittle or frayed wires to ensure reliable performance in conjunction with the new spark plugs.
How Can You Diagnose Spark Plug Issues in a 1986 Chevy C20?
You can diagnose spark plug issues in a 1986 Chevy C20 by checking for wear, inspecting for carbon build-up, measuring electrode gap, and examining the ignition system.
-
Checking for wear: Remove each spark plug and examine them for signs of wear, such as visible damage or corrosion. This can indicate that the spark plugs need replacement. Worn plugs may have rounded electrodes or a discolored appearance.
-
Inspecting for carbon build-up: Look for black, sooty deposits on the spark plugs. This carbon build-up suggests incomplete combustion, which could result from a rich fuel mixture, faulty injectors, or weak ignition. Cleaning or replacing the plugs may be necessary.
-
Measuring electrode gap: Use a spark plug gap tool to measure the gap between the electrodes. The gap should match the manufacturer specifications, typically 0.035 inches for a 1986 Chevy C20. An incorrect gap can lead to misfiring or poor engine performance.
-
Examining the ignition system: Check the ignition wires and coil for signs of wear or damage. Faulty ignition components can affect spark plug function. Replace worn wires or coils to ensure consistent spark delivery.
By performing these steps, you can effectively diagnose spark plug issues in your vehicle and restore optimal engine performance.
